登录
首页精彩阅读python实现每次处理一个字符的三种方法
python实现每次处理一个字符的三种方法
2017-08-30
收藏

python实现每次处理一个字符的三种方法

这篇文章主要介绍了python实现每次处理一个字符的三种方法,是非常实用的字符串操作技巧,需要的朋友可以参考下

本文实例讲述了python每次处理一个字符的三种方法。
具体方法如下:    
a_string = "abccdea"
 
print 'the first'
for c in a_string:
  print ord(c)+1
 
    
print "the second"  
result = [ord(c)+1 for c in a_string]
print result
 
print "the thrid"
 
def do_something(c):
  return ord(c)+1
 
result = map(do_something ,a_string)
print result

打印出的结果如下:
    
the first
98
99
100
100
101
102
98
the second
[98, 99, 100, 100, 101, 102, 98]
the thrid
[98, 99, 100, 100, 101, 102, 98]
希望本文所述对大家的Python程序设计有所帮助。


数据分析咨询请扫描二维码

客服在线
立即咨询